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"for their review"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ing a document or material that you or someone else has submitted for others to review. For example, "I emailed the report to the board members for their review."

Linguistic Context

The phrase "for their review" functions as a prepositional phrase, typically used as an adverbial modifier. It indicates the purpose or reason for an action, specifying that something is provided to someone for the purpose of being reviewed. Ludwig AI confirms this through numerous examples.

FAQs

How to use "for their review" in a sentence?

You can use "for their review" to indicate that something is being submitted to someone for evaluation. For example, "The report was sent to the committee "for their review"."

What can I say instead of "for their review"?

Alternatives include "for their consideration", "for their assessment", or "to get their feedback", depending on the specific context.

Is "for their review" formal or informal?

"For their review" is generally considered neutral and can be used in both formal and informal contexts. The formality of the surrounding language will influence the overall tone.

What's the difference between "for their review" and "for their approval"?

"For their review" implies an evaluation, while "for their approval" suggests a decision is needed. Review precedes a decision, while approval indicates a decision is required.
